The Rise of the Eating Challenge: More Than Just a Meal

The phenomenon of competitive eating, particularly in the form of localized food challenges, has exploded in popularity in recent years. This can be partly attributed to social media; the visual spectacle of a mountain of food, the dramatic countdown, and the sheer determination (or hilarious failure) of the challenger make for undeniably engaging content. A successful completion of a Seattle food challenge instantly grants bragging rights and widespread social media recognition. Besides the fame, restaurants use them as a powerful marketing tool, drawing crowds and generating buzz. A failed challenge keeps hungry customers coming back to try again. And then there’s the prize, a free meal, a coveted t-shirt, or a spot on a restaurant’s esteemed Wall of Fame. Food challenges cater to our desire for spectacle and offer an accessible way to test our limits.

Strategies for Success: The Food Challenge Playbook

Tackling a Seattle food challenge requires more than just a big appetite. Strategic preparation and execution are essential for survival.

Physical Preparation: Laying the Groundwork

Before attempting a large-quantity food challenge, it is advised to slowly increase stomach capacity over time. However, it is crucial to emphasize responsible and gradual adjustments, avoiding any dangerous or unhealthy practices. Hydration is also paramount. Drink plenty of water in the days leading up to the challenge to prepare your stomach.

Mental Fortitude: The Power of Mind Over Matter

Food challenges are as much a mental battle as they are a physical one. Maintaining focus and determination is key, especially when you start to feel full or overwhelmed. It is best to visualize success, and keep your eye on the prize.

Eating Techniques: Mastering the Art of Consumption

Pacing is crucial. Don’t start too fast, as you’ll burn out quickly. Find a rhythm that works for you and stick to it. Chewing thoroughly is essential for digestion, but balance chewing and swallowing efficiently. Staying properly hydrated is the key. Water aids in digestion and helps to prevent you from feeling too full. Avoid sugary drinks.

What Not to Do: Avoid These Common Pitfalls

Arriving with a stomach already full is an obvious recipe for disaster. Avoid eating a large meal beforehand. Carbonated beverages can fill your stomach with gas and make you feel bloated. Avoid them at all costs. The most common mistake made during a food challenge is giving up mentally. Even when you feel like you can’t eat another bite, push through.

A Grain of Salt: The Ethics and Considerations of Food Challenges

While Seattle’s food challenges offer an exciting opportunity for culinary adventure, it’s important to consider the ethical implications.

Potential Health Risks: Listen to Your Body

Participating in a food challenge can put a strain on your digestive system. While most challengers experience only temporary discomfort, it is possible for more serious health issues to happen. If you have any underlying health conditions, consult with a doctor before attempting a food challenge.

Food Waste: A Responsible Approach

Food waste is a serious global problem, and it’s important to be mindful of the potential for waste associated with food challenges. Consider whether attempting the challenge aligns with your values. You can consider donating to local food banks to minimize the impact of the food waste.
